【摘要】:睪丸是雄禽最重要的生殖器官,睪丸組織中的神經(jīng)系統(tǒng)對精子的產(chǎn)生、雄激素的分泌等生殖功能具有十分關(guān)鍵的作用.神經(jīng)系統(tǒng)通常由大量的神經(jīng)元構(gòu)成,突觸是神經(jīng)元之間的接觸點(diǎn),也是信息傳遞的關(guān)鍵部位.突觸傳遞過程是由神經(jīng)遞質(zhì)釋放并作用于突觸后膜完成的.因此,研究家禽睪丸神經(jīng)遞質(zhì)的種類、分布及其相關(guān)功能對進(jìn)一步了解家禽生殖功能具有十分重要的意義.本文主要概述膽堿能、胺能、肽能以及氨基酸能等神經(jīng)系統(tǒng)中較為典型的神經(jīng)遞質(zhì),為睪丸神經(jīng)調(diào)控方面的研究提供一定的參考資料.
[Abstract]:Testis are the most important reproductive organs of male birds. The nervous system in testicular tissue plays a very important role in sperm production, androgen secretion and other reproductive functions. The nervous system is usually composed of a large number of neurons. Synapses are the point of contact between neurons and a key part of the transmission of information. The process of synaptic transmission is accomplished by the release of neurotransmitters and acts on the postsynaptic membrane. Distribution and its related functions are of great significance for further understanding the reproductive function of poultry. This paper reviews the typical neurotransmitters in the nervous system, such as cholinergic, aminergic, peptidergic and amino acid energy. To provide some reference for the study of testicular nerve regulation.
